iProspect elects new global chief client strategy officer

Dentsu owned media company, iProspect, has appointed Josh Dwiggins to its global chief client strategy officer role.

The news comes one year after the firm relaunched as a digital-first end to end media agency.

Dwiggins has 22 years of experience in the industry, having previously worked for Publicis’ Perfomics, Reprise Media (IPG), JobScience, Financial Visions and CDG. 

“For over two decades, Dwiggins has focused on helping some of the largest brands including, Microsoft, Google, Twitter and Toyota, buy and engage their most valuable customers in real time, with a focus on performance media: search, programmatic, mobile, social, video and ecommerce,” iProspect said.

In his new role he will be responsible for executing the media company’s new performance-driven brand-building proposition and also leading strategy teams in providing continuous growth and efficiency.

“Having Josh onboard in this role is a huge boost for us at iProspect as we continue to go from strength to strength under the new direction of the agency,” iProspect global client and brand president, Amanda Morrissey said.

“His ability to see the full context in which we and our clients operate, and craft innovative solutions will really help accelerate our clients’ plans globally.”

Dwiggins will be based in the Bay Area, California, USA.

He added: iProspect has always been an enticing destination for mebut joining now, as the company cements its combined brand and performance offering, makes it all the sweeter and more satisfying for my own personal growth.”

“I’ve always been someone who likes to try new things, with the vast team and integrated dentsu services around the world, I’ve now got the tools, talent and resources to help build a new industry excellence benchmark for the future.
